Private Household Cook matches Direct service providing personal satisfaction; Public Warehouse Operator matches Commercial auxiliary occupation providing storage; Personal Family Doctor matches Direct service offering personal healthcare; Commercial Freight Transporter matches Commercial auxiliary occupation facilitating physical distribution of goods.
Direct service occupations (like private domestic cooks and family physicians) directly serve individuals for personal satisfaction, whereas commercial service occupations (such as freight transporters and warehouse keepers) act as auxiliaries to trade that enable the smooth distribution and exchange of commodities.
